Protein Name: 1-phosphatidylinositol 4,5-bisphosphate phosphodiesterase beta-3

UniprotKB/SwissProt ID: P51432 (P51432)

Gene Name: Plcb3

Organism: Mus musculus (Mouse)

Function: Catalyzes the production of the second messenger molecules diacylglycerol (DAG) and inositol 1,4,5-trisphosphate (IP3) (By similarity). Key transducer of G protein-coupled receptor signaling: activated by G(q)/G(11) G alpha proteins downstream of G protein-coupled receptors activation (PubMed:22728827). In neutrophils, participates in a phospholipase C-activating N-formyl peptide-activated GPCR (G protein-coupled receptor) signaling pathway by promoting RASGRP4 activation by DAG, to promote neutrophil functional responses (PubMed:22728827)

Other Modifications: View all modification sites in dbPTM

Protein Subcellular Localization: Cytoplasm. Membrane. Nucleus
